Is Programming Required For Cyber Security?

How do I succeed in cyber security career?

Earn a bachelor’s degree in computer science, information technology, cybersecurity or a related field.

Or, gain equivalent experience with relevant industry certifications.

Enter the field as a programmer or analyst.

Get promoted to a role as a security analyst, engineer, consultant or auditor..

What programming language is used for cyber security?

PythonIn cyber security, Python is used to conduct many cyber security tasks like scanning and analyzing malware. Python is a helpful step towards more sophisticated programming languages, too. It offers a high level of web readability and is used by tech’s largest companies, including Google, Reddit, and NASA.

What knowledge is required for cyber security?

A solid grounding in IT fundamentals (web applications, system administration) Coding skills (C, C++. Java, PHP, Perl, Ruby, Python) Understanding architecture, administration and operating systems.

Is Cyber Security hard?

Cyber security degrees tend to be more challenging than non-research type majors, such as programs in the humanities or business, but are usually not as difficult as degrees in research or lab intensive areas, such as science and engineering.

Is cybersecurity a good career?

As the Internet grows, so does cybercrime. Luckily for cyber security professionals, this generates great demand for jobs. According to the Bureau of Labor Statistics (BLS), employment of Information Security Analysts is projected to grow 37 percent from 2012 to 2022, which is much faster than average.

Is C++ used in cyber security?

Although many languages can be useful for a career in cybersecurity, C++ plays an important role. This is mainly because C++ is a powerful, low-level programming language that can access hardware and low-level IT infrastructure, such as RAM and system processes, which are often most vulnerable to hacking attacks.

Is C++ Good for cyber security?

C and C++ are critical low-level programming languages that you need to know as a cyber security professional. These languages provide access to low-level IT infrastructure such as RAM and system processes, which if not well protected, hackers can easily exploit.

What skills do cyber security analysts need?

3 Crucial Soft Skills for Cybersecurity AnalystsCommunication skills. In the event of a cyber attack, a security analyst must communicate the problem and coordinate an incident response with other members of the security team. … Curiosity. … Attention to detail.

How many hours a week do cyber security work?

40 hoursMost work 40 hours per week.

Is python needed for cyber security?

Python is an advantageous programming language for cybersecurity because it can perform many cybersecurity functions, including malware analysis, scanning, and penetration testing functions. It is user-friendly and has an elegant simplicity, making it the perfect language choice for many cybersecurity professionals.

Why is cybersecurity so hard?

But if you look at the challenge more broadly, even if we resolved the technical issues, cybersecurity would remain a hard problem for three reasons: It’s not just a technical problem. The rules of cyberspace are different from the physical world’s. Cybersecurity law, policy, and practice are not yet fully developed.

Is C++ hard to learn?

C++ is the hardest language for students to master, mostly because they have to think much. … Many other popular languages provide some cool “features” allowing developers to concentrate on their actual problem, instead of worrying about language-specific quirks (agree, C++ has so many of them).

Can I learn cyber security on my own?

While more and more colleges and universities worldwide offer degree programs in computer security, far from all academic institutions have launched such programs. Indeed, many experts in the field are self-taught and/or have acquired their skills through various non-academic courses and certifications.

Is it hard to become a cyber security specialist?

Even though a job in cybersecurity can be highly rewarding and satisfying, it can also be very challenging and stressful. Understanding some of the job responsibilities, as well as the characteristics and personality traits of these jobs, may help you decide if a career in cybersecurity is right for you.

Is coding required for cyber security?

So, does cybersecurity require coding? The majority of entry-level cybersecurity jobs do not require coding skills. However, being able to write and understand code may be necessary in some mid-level and upper-level cybersecurity positions that you will become qualified for after you’ve built a few years of experience.

Does Cyber Security pay well?

The average cybersecurity salary for this position falls between $90,000 and $160,000, and they are worth every penny. These security professionals help create, plan, and carry out security measures to keep your infrastructure secure.

How long is Cyber Security School?

four yearsMost online cybersecurity bachelor’s degrees take four years and about 120 credits to complete. However, you may be able to finish your degree faster if you have college credits from a previous institution or Advanced Placement scores.

Is Python less secure?

Now it’s Python’s time to boast. On average, it has the lowest amount of high security vulnerabilities over the past 5 years. In 2018, security vulnerabilities in the language decreased and has overall been decreasing since 2015.